In the first game of the M-Enovos League 1/4 finals, Arantia Larochette secured a decisive victory over Basket Esch with a final score of 88-69. The game, held at Esch, saw Arantia Larochette take control early, leading after each quarter and sealing their win with a strong fourth quarter performance.
Arantia Larochette's offensive prowess was on full display, particularly through Scott Christopher Lindsey, who scored an impressive 49 points. Lindsey's performance was complemented by Kiandre Marquis Gaddy, who added 18 points. Both players were instrumental in maintaining Arantia's lead throughout the game. Lindsey's scoring included several crucial three-pointers, contributing to Arantia's 42% success rate from beyond the arc.
Basket Esch struggled to keep pace despite a commendable effort from Quinten Gregory Dee Nelson, who led his team with 29 points. Jordan Hicks also contributed with 15 points, showcasing his skills as a guard. However, Basket Esch's shooting percentages were less effective, particularly from the three-point line, where they managed only 22%.
The game saw a series of scoring runs, with Arantia Larochette at one point extending their lead significantly. Basket Esch attempted to rally, but Arantia's consistent scoring and defensive efforts thwarted their comeback attempts. Notably, Thomas Grun of Basket Esch, a key player, faced foul trouble, which limited his impact on the game.
The victory places Arantia Larochette in a favorable position in the series, while Basket Esch will need to regroup and strategize for the upcoming games. Both teams remain active in the championship, with Arantia currently ranked third and Basket Esch sixth in the league standings.
